Abstract
The invention belongs to oil drilling and extracting equipment field there is provided a kind of new iron driller caliper clamping slips, the slips body that new iron driller caliper is clamped in slips is fixed on the inside groove center of slip spider;Two telescopic oil cylinders are arranged on slips body both sides, are axisymmetricly distributed, both sides telescopic oil cylinder is fixed in slip spider inside groove;Piston rod one end of flexible oil is moved freely in hydraulic cylinder, and the other end is connected with one end of oil cylinder hinged seat by bearing pin, and the other end of oil cylinder hinged seat is fixed by bearing pin with slips connecting plate;When iron driller is in clamp position, stretched out by both sides telescopic oil cylinder piston rod, drive the movement of slips connecting plate, and then internal slips body is inwardly gathered, reach the effect for clamping oil pipe.The present invention can prevent oil-pipe external wall concentrated wear, easily realize clamping Automated condtrol, facilitate oil pipe to clamp, can be easy to be applied in various automatic oil pipe chucking devices.
Description
Technical field
The invention belongs to oil drilling and extracting equipment field, and in particular to a kind of oil drilling removes the automation clamping machine of drilling rod
Structure.
Background technology
Oil is the extremely important industrial energy in the world today, in recent years, with continuing to develop for oil drilling industry, stone
Oily exploitation field proposes higher and higher technical requirements for oil equipment.Tube apparatus is removed, oil pipe mobile device is oil field
Interior capital equipment, and oil pipe clamping mechanism is one of common main part of above equipment, therefore oil pipe clamping machine
Structure improves and innovation has more important practical significance.The clamping device that current iron driller is used has following defect:1st, different mouths
The oil well in footpath needs various sizes of oil pipe, thus needs frequently change grip block at work and clamping device is more multiple
Miscellaneous, the loading and unloading of grip block is also comparatively laborious, it is impossible to meet change in oil pipe in the range of certain size job requirement 2,
The grip block of some oil pipe clamping mechanisms skewness around oil pipe causes oil-pipe external wall concentrated wear.3rd, current well head is normal
It is low with the automatic and mechanical degree of elevator, the manually operated of workman is fully relied on, the working strength of workman is big, work limitation
It is low, and there is potential safety hazard during oil pipe handling.
The content of the invention
In order to solve the above technical problems, the present invention provides a kind of new iron driller caliper clamping slips.
The technical scheme is that:
A kind of new iron driller caliper clamping slips, including oil cylinder hinged seat 1, slips connecting plate 2, slip spider 3, slips body
5th, telescopic oil cylinder 6, steel spring plate 10.Wherein, slips body 5 is bolted in the inside groove of slip spider 3, and in centre bit
Put;Two telescopic oil cylinders 6 are arranged on the both sides of slips body 5, are axisymmetricly distributed, both sides telescopic oil cylinder 6 is fixed on card by bearing pin
In watt inside groove of seat 3;Piston rod one end of telescopic oil cylinder 6 is moved freely in hydraulic cylinder, one end of the other end and oil cylinder hinged seat 1
Connected by bearing pin, the other end of oil cylinder hinged seat 1 is fixed by bearing pin with slips connecting plate 2, passes through telescopic oil cylinder piston rod
It is displaced outwardly, drives both sides slips connecting plate 2 to gather to inner side, reaches the effect of automation clamping.
Described slips body 5 includes clamping the first chain link 7 of dental lamina 4, slips, middle shot 9, slips tail chain section 11;Described
One end of slips head chain links 7 is fixedly connected by bearing pin with side slips connecting plate 2, the other end and the middle shot 9 of first chain link 7
One end be hinged by bearing pin and sliding bearing 8;The other end of middle shot 9 passes through bearing pin and sliding bearing 8 and slips tail chain
One end of section 11 is hinged, and the other end of slips tail chain section 11 is fixedly connected by bearing pin with the slips connecting plate 2 of opposite side;Work as iron
When driller is in clamp position, the piston rod of both sides telescopic oil cylinder 6 stretches out, and drives slips connecting plate 2 to move, and then make internal slips
Body 5 is inwardly gathered, and reaches the effect for clamping oil pipe.Described clamping dental lamina 4 is bolted on slips chain link inner surface, when
When chain link is gathered, slip dog 4 is moved with chain link, when clamping dental lamina 4 touches oil pipe outer surface, is adsorbed in outer wall simultaneously
And conventional dentation pincers tooth can be avoided directly to bite oil-pipe external wall, stress raisers are caused to the damage at oil connection.Institute
Two steel spring plates 10 stated are located at the outside of slips chain link, and the two ends of steel spring plate 10 are connected by bolt with adjustment cover plate 12
Connect, adjustment cover plate 12 is fixed on the slips backplate 2 of both sides, by applying outside to chain link through chain link projection
Power, the uncertain rotation for limiting link ensures that clamping device remains class round shape, facilitates oil pipe to clamp.
Beneficial effects of the present invention:1. clamp force distribution suffered by tubing wall is uniformly prevented oil pipe using chain gripper mechanism
Outer wall concentrated wear;2. oil cylinder is flexible to realize that gear grips can obtain reliable clamping force and easily realize clamping automation
Control, is easy to be applied in various automatic oil pipe chucking devices;3. two latch plates apply through chain link projection to chain link
The uncertain rotation that outside tension force can limit link makes clamping device remain class round shape, facilitates oil pipe to clamp;4. chain
The design of section projection increases chain link with the contact area of its support base to improve the reliability of clamping device;5. chain internode
Using bearing pin and distal opening pin connection, facilitate dismounting and change, and can be by increasing or decreasing chain link number and selecting suitable
When the oil cylinder of stroke to adapt to the oil pipe of different dimensions.
